Itoman Sunshine Hours by Month
Sunshine is key to understanding how a place experiences its seasons. This page shows the total number of hours of direct sunlight per month and the average hours per day in Itoman, Okinawa islands, Japan. The numbers reflect climate data gathered over a 30-year period, from 1990 to 2020.
Monthly hours of sunshine
Sunshine in Itoman varies greatly throughout the year. The sunniest month, July, reaches an impressive 240 hours, while February, the darkest month, offers only 88 hours. The total annual amount of sun is 1790 hours.
Daily hours of sunshine
For those who appreciate different seasons, Itoman ser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in July with an average of 8.0 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in February, offering only 2.9 hours of daily sunlight.

Related Climate Data for Itoman
June, Itoman’s wettest month, receives 139 mm (5.5 in) of rainfall and has a maximum daytime temperature of 28°C (82°F). During the driest month November you can expect a temperature of 25°C (77°F).
